i guess it's getting pretty close now. they've got the power steering pump clocked to allow more room for the new intakes, he's ordered a 75mm bbk throttle body so they can get the charge piping going, all the oil seals have been replaced, timing is done, provisions have been added for the wastegate, and a few other misc. things. i guess all that's left is the charge piping and to find a standalone. i'm trying to work something out with that right now, and i've also got a line on a nice v-band exhaust housing for the turbo. getting really close now.
